- [ ] Step 7: Archive cold storage buckets (Glacierline tier). Confirm both ceremony witnesses are present, verify bucket manifests match the Oxbow ledger, then seal the archive key shares. Plugin authors may observe but not handle shares. Once sealed, the archive index itself is encrypted and can only be reopened with the passphrase below.

vault phrase of badup-hahig = tamael-aldael-kelmir-istael-fenok-istwyn-tamius-jorath-oliion

Handover: Orphan Sweeper (Brackwell Cloud)

Taking over from Priya's rotation. The sweeper scans for detached volumes and stale snapshots every six hours; plugin authors should note that anything tagged `keep=true` is skipped, no exceptions. Third-party plugins register a claim callback — if your callback times out twice, the resource is treated as orphaned, so keep it fast. Dry-run mode logs instead of deleting. The current production sweep configuration is as follows.

deployment values, fadug-bawif:
SORWYN_LOG_LEVEL=debug
SORWYN_METRICS_HOST=metrics.sorwyn.qirvansys.internal
SORWYN_POOL_SIZE=32

Q: Why did list queries get faster in Orvane's catalog API?

A: We fixed the GraphQL N+1 problem. Resolvers now batch through a dataloader in `loaders/variant.ts` instead of firing per-row lookups. Don't call the repository directly from resolvers — route everything through loaders. Benchmarks live in `perf/notes.md`. To access the profiling dashboard archive, unlock it with the passphrase below.

unlock words, fafop-hawep: briwyn-oliix-sorox